Caught in a maddening traffic jam, as you lose patience, all you are left to do is honk, curse and crib. It’s a situation you certainly hate, yet can’t escape. Interestingly, the West Bengal government has come up with a one-of-its-kind cure for stress due to traffic jams. They have decided to play Rabindra Sangeet on loudspeakers at traffic signals across Kolkata.
